Is ayatul Kursi a surah?Īyatul Kursi is the Verse of Surah Al-Baqarah. Of the 114 chapters in the Quran, 86 are classified as Meccan, while 28 are Medinan. The chapters or surahs are of unequal length, the shortest surah (Al-Kawthar) has only three verses while the longest (Al-Baqara) contains 286 verses. There are 114 surahs in the Quran, each divided into ayats (verses). It is likely the most well known ayat across the entire Ummah, estimation is that hundreds of million of people know it by heart. This verse is ayah 255 from Surah Baqarah commonly referred to as Ayatul Kursi (meaning “The Throne”). They are the easiest chapters in the Quran to memorize given their short length, about 4–6 lines each.

Together they are commonly referred to as the four Quls. Qul Al-Nas, Qul Al-Falaq, Qul Al-Ikhlas and Qul Al-Kafiroun.

What Are The Four Quls of the Quran? The four quls are just four surahs (chapters) of the Quran that begin with the word Qul. The 4 Qul Surahs are mentioned below: Surah al-Kafirun.
